Skip to content

GET /probes/my/

List all RIPE Atlas probes managed by the authenticated user.

GET /probes/my/ — asn

Only include probes with an IPv4 or IPv6 address announced by this ASN.

GET /probes/my/ — asn46diff

Only include probes where the announced ASN of the IPv4 and IPv6 addresses differ.

GET /probes/my/ — asn_v4

Only include probes with an IPv4 address announced by this ASN.

GET /probes/my/ — asn_v4__in

Only include probes with an IPv4 address announced by an ASN in this comma-separated list.

GET /probes/my/ — asn_v6

Only include probes with an IPv6 address announced by this ASN.

GET /probes/my/ — asn_v6__in

Only include probes with an IPv4 address announced by an ASN in this comma-separatedd list.

GET /probes/my/ — country_code

Only include probes in this country (ISO 3166-1 alpha-2 code).

GET /probes/my/ — country_code__in

Only include probes in any of the countries in this comma-separated list of ISO 3166-1 alpha-2 codes.

GET /probes/my/ — favourite

Filter by whether the probe is in the authenticated user's favourites.

GET /probes/my/ — fields

Comma-separated list of fields to include in response, in addition to 'type' and 'id' which are always present. Optional fields can be listed here also.

GET /probes/my/ — firmware_version

Only include probes running this firmware version.

GET /probes/my/ — format

GET /probes/my/ — format[datetime]

Output datetimes in ISO-8601 format ('iso-8601' or 'json') or as seconds since the epoch ('unix' or 'timestamp')

GET /probes/my/ — hidden

Filter by whether the probe is in the authenticated user's hidden/archived list.

GET /probes/my/ — id__gt

Only include probes with IDs greater than this value.

GET /probes/my/ — id__gte

Only include probes with IDs greater than or equal to this value.

GET /probes/my/ — id__in

Only include probes with IDs in this comma-separated list.

GET /probes/my/ — id__lt

Only include probes with IDs less than this value.

GET /probes/my/ — id__lte

Only include probes with IDs less than or equal to this value.

GET /probes/my/ — include

Include additional fields named in comma-separated values in response as nested JSON objects.

GET /probes/my/ — is_anchor

Only include anchors.

GET /probes/my/ — is_public

Only include probes marked as public.

GET /probes/my/ — latitude

Only include probes at exactly this latitude (in degrees).

GET /probes/my/ — latitude__gt

Only include probes with a latitude greater than this value (in degrees).

GET /probes/my/ — latitude__gte

Only include probes with a latitude greater than or equal to this value (in degrees).

GET /probes/my/ — latitude__lt

Only include probes with a latitude less than this value (in degrees).

GET /probes/my/ — latitude__lte

Only include probes with a latitude less than or equal to this value (in degrees).

GET /probes/my/ — longitude

Only include probes at exactly this longitude (in degrees).

GET /probes/my/ — longitude__gt

Only include probes with a longitude greater than this value (in degrees).

GET /probes/my/ — longitude__gte

Only include probes with a longitude greater than or equal to this value (in degrees).

GET /probes/my/ — longitude__lt

Only include probes with a longitude less than this value (in degrees).

GET /probes/my/ — longitude__lte

Only include probes with a longitude less than or equal to this value (in degrees).

GET /probes/my/ — optional_fields

Comma-separated list of optional fields named to include in response objects.

GET /probes/my/ — page

A page number within the paginated result set.

GET /probes/my/ — page_size

Number of results to return per page.

GET /probes/my/ — prefix_v4

Only include probes whose IPv4 address falls within this prefix (e.g. 192.0.2.0/24).

GET /probes/my/ — prefix_v6

Only include probes whose IPv6 address falls within this prefix (e.g. 2001:db8::/32).

GET /probes/my/ — radius

Only include probes within a given radius, expressed as 'lat,lon:radius' where lat/lon are in degrees and radius is in kilometres.

Search probes by description, ID, or ASN.

GET /probes/my/ — sort

Which field to use when ordering the results.

GET /probes/my/ — status

Only include probes with this status (numeric value).

  • 0 - Never Connected
  • 1 - Connected
  • 2 - Disconnected
  • 3 - Abandoned
  • 4 - Written Off

GET /probes/my/ — status__in

Only include probes whose status is in this comma-separated list of numeric values.

  • 0 - Never Connected
  • 1 - Connected
  • 2 - Disconnected
  • 3 - Abandoned
  • 4 - Written Off

GET /probes/my/ — status_name

Only include probes with this status (human-readable name).

  • Never Connected - Never Connected
  • Connected - Connected
  • Disconnected - Disconnected
  • Abandoned - Abandoned
  • Written Off - Written Off

GET /probes/my/ — tags

Only include probes matching all tags in this comma-separated list.

GET /api/v2/probes/my/

List all RIPE Atlas probes managed by the authenticated user.

Try it out

Playground

Authorization
Variables
Key
Value
Authorizations

Authorizations

api-key
Type
API Key (header: Authorization)
or
ripe-access
Type
API Key (cookie: crowd.token_key)
Parameters

Query Parameters

asn

Only include probes with an IPv4 or IPv6 address announced by this ASN.

Type
number
asn46diff

Only include probes where the announced ASN of the IPv4 and IPv6 addresses differ.

Type
boolean
asn_v4

Only include probes with an IPv4 address announced by this ASN.

Type
integer
asn_v4__in

Only include probes with an IPv4 address announced by an ASN in this comma-separated list.

Type
integer
Maximum
2147483647
Minimum
-2147483648
asn_v6

Only include probes with an IPv6 address announced by this ASN.

Type
integer
asn_v6__in

Only include probes with an IPv4 address announced by an ASN in this comma-separatedd list.

Type
integer
Maximum
2147483647
Minimum
-2147483648
country_code

Only include probes in this country (ISO 3166-1 alpha-2 code).

Type
string
Valid values
"""AD""AE""AF""AG""AI""AL""AM""AO""AQ""AR""AS""AT""AU""AW""AX""AZ""BA""BB""BD""BE""BF""BG""BH""BI""BJ""BL""BM""BN""BO""BQ""BR""BS""BT""BV""BW""BY""BZ""CA""CC""CD""CF""CG""CH""CI""CK""CL""CM""CN""CO""CR""CU""CV""CW""CX""CY""CZ""DE""DJ""DK""DM""DO""DZ""EC""EE""EG""EH""ER""ES""ET""FI""FJ""FK""FM""FO""FR""GA""GB""GD""GE""GF""GG""GH""GI""GL""GM""GN""GP""GQ""GR""GS""GT""GU""GW""GY""HK""HM""HN""HR""HT""HU""ID""IE""IL""IM""IN""IO""IQ""IR""IS""IT""JE""JM""JO""JP""KE""KG""KH""KI""KM""KN""KP""KR""KW""KY""KZ""LA""LB""LC""LI""LK""LR""LS""LT""LU""LV""LY""MA""MC""MD""ME""MF""MG""MH""MK""ML""MM""MN""MO""MP""MQ""MR""MS""MT""MU""MV""MW""MX""MY""MZ""NA""NC""NE""NF""NG""NI""NL""NO""NP""NR""NU""NZ"null"OM""PA""PE""PF""PG""PH""PK""PL""PM""PN""PR""PS""PT""PW""PY""QA""RE""RO""RS""RU""RW""SA""SB""SC""SD""SE""SG""SH""SI""SJ""SK""SL""SM""SN""SO""SR""SS""ST""SV""SX""SY""SZ""TC""TD""TF""TG""TH""TJ""TK""TL""TM""TN""TO""TR""TT""TV""TW""TZ""UA""UG""UM""US""UY""UZ""VA""VC""VE""VG""VI""VN""VU""WF""WS""YE""YT""ZA""ZM""ZW"
country_code__in

Only include probes in any of the countries in this comma-separated list of ISO 3166-1 alpha-2 codes.

Type
string
Valid values
"""AD""AE""AF""AG""AI""AL""AM""AO""AQ""AR""AS""AT""AU""AW""AX""AZ""BA""BB""BD""BE""BF""BG""BH""BI""BJ""BL""BM""BN""BO""BQ""BR""BS""BT""BV""BW""BY""BZ""CA""CC""CD""CF""CG""CH""CI""CK""CL""CM""CN""CO""CR""CU""CV""CW""CX""CY""CZ""DE""DJ""DK""DM""DO""DZ""EC""EE""EG""EH""ER""ES""ET""FI""FJ""FK""FM""FO""FR""GA""GB""GD""GE""GF""GG""GH""GI""GL""GM""GN""GP""GQ""GR""GS""GT""GU""GW""GY""HK""HM""HN""HR""HT""HU""ID""IE""IL""IM""IN""IO""IQ""IR""IS""IT""JE""JM""JO""JP""KE""KG""KH""KI""KM""KN""KP""KR""KW""KY""KZ""LA""LB""LC""LI""LK""LR""LS""LT""LU""LV""LY""MA""MC""MD""ME""MF""MG""MH""MK""ML""MM""MN""MO""MP""MQ""MR""MS""MT""MU""MV""MW""MX""MY""MZ""NA""NC""NE""NF""NG""NI""NL""NO""NP""NR""NU""NZ"null"OM""PA""PE""PF""PG""PH""PK""PL""PM""PN""PR""PS""PT""PW""PY""QA""RE""RO""RS""RU""RW""SA""SB""SC""SD""SE""SG""SH""SI""SJ""SK""SL""SM""SN""SO""SR""SS""ST""SV""SX""SY""SZ""TC""TD""TF""TG""TH""TJ""TK""TL""TM""TN""TO""TR""TT""TV""TW""TZ""UA""UG""UM""US""UY""UZ""VA""VC""VE""VG""VI""VN""VU""WF""WS""YE""YT""ZA""ZM""ZW"
favourite

Filter by whether the probe is in the authenticated user's favourites.

Type
boolean
fields

Comma-separated list of fields to include in response, in addition to 'type' and 'id' which are always present. Optional fields can be listed here also.

Type
string
firmware_version

Only include probes running this firmware version.

Type
number
format
Type
string
Valid values
"geojson""json""txt"
format[datetime]

Output datetimes in ISO-8601 format ('iso-8601' or 'json') or as seconds since the epoch ('unix' or 'timestamp')

Type
string
Valid values
"iso-8601""json""timestamp""unix"
hidden

Filter by whether the probe is in the authenticated user's hidden/archived list.

Type
boolean
id__gt

Only include probes with IDs greater than this value.

Type
number
id__gte

Only include probes with IDs greater than or equal to this value.

Type
number
id__in

Only include probes with IDs in this comma-separated list.

Type
integer
id__lt

Only include probes with IDs less than this value.

Type
number
id__lte

Only include probes with IDs less than or equal to this value.

Type
number
include

Include additional fields named in comma-separated values in response as nested JSON objects.

Type
string
Valid values
"measurements"
is_anchor

Only include anchors.

Type
boolean
is_public

Only include probes marked as public.

Type
boolean
latitude

Only include probes at exactly this latitude (in degrees).

Type
number
Format
"float"
latitude__gt

Only include probes with a latitude greater than this value (in degrees).

Type
number
Format
"float"
latitude__gte

Only include probes with a latitude greater than or equal to this value (in degrees).

Type
number
Format
"float"
latitude__lt

Only include probes with a latitude less than this value (in degrees).

Type
number
Format
"float"
latitude__lte

Only include probes with a latitude less than or equal to this value (in degrees).

Type
number
Format
"float"
longitude

Only include probes at exactly this longitude (in degrees).

Type
number
Format
"float"
longitude__gt

Only include probes with a longitude greater than this value (in degrees).

Type
number
Format
"float"
longitude__gte

Only include probes with a longitude greater than or equal to this value (in degrees).

Type
number
Format
"float"
longitude__lt

Only include probes with a longitude less than this value (in degrees).

Type
number
Format
"float"
longitude__lte

Only include probes with a longitude less than or equal to this value (in degrees).

Type
number
Format
"float"
optional_fields

Comma-separated list of optional fields named to include in response objects.

Type
string
Valid values
"country_name""measurements""connection_af""connection_controller"
page

A page number within the paginated result set.

Type
integer
page_size

Number of results to return per page.

Type
integer
prefix_v4

Only include probes whose IPv4 address falls within this prefix (e.g. 192.0.2.0/24).

Type
string
prefix_v6

Only include probes whose IPv6 address falls within this prefix (e.g. 2001:db8::/32).

Type
string
radius

Only include probes within a given radius, expressed as 'lat,lon:radius' where lat/lon are in degrees and radius is in kilometres.

Type
string
search

Search probes by description, ID, or ASN.

Type
string
sort

Which field to use when ordering the results.

Type
string
status

Only include probes with this status (numeric value).

  • 0 - Never Connected
  • 1 - Connected
  • 2 - Disconnected
  • 3 - Abandoned
  • 4 - Written Off
Type
integer
Valid values
01234"null"
status__in

Only include probes whose status is in this comma-separated list of numeric values.

  • 0 - Never Connected
  • 1 - Connected
  • 2 - Disconnected
  • 3 - Abandoned
  • 4 - Written Off
Type
integer
Valid values
01234
status_name

Only include probes with this status (human-readable name).

  • Never Connected - Never Connected
  • Connected - Connected
  • Disconnected - Disconnected
  • Abandoned - Abandoned
  • Written Off - Written Off
Type
integer
Valid values
"Abandoned""Connected""Disconnected""Never Connected""Written Off"
tags

Only include probes matching all tags in this comma-separated list.

Type
string
Responses

Responses

object
Format"uri"
Format"uri"
object[]
Required

The last IPv4 address that was known to be held by this probe, or null if there is no known address. Note: a probe that connects over IPv6 may fail to report its IPv4 address, meaning that this field can sometimes be null even though the probe may have working IPv4

The last IPv6 address that was known to be held by this probe, or null if there is no known address.

The IPv4 ASN if any

The IPv6 ASN if any

An ISO-3166-1 alpha-2 code indicating the country that this probe is located in,
as derived from the user supplied longitude and latitude

User defined description of the probe

When the probe connected for the first time (UTC Time and date in ISO-8601/ECMA 262 format)

Format"date-time"

A GeoJSON point object containing the user-supplied location of this probe.
The longitude and latitude are contained within the coordinates array

Format"double"

The id of the probe

Whether or not this probe is a RIPE Atlas Anchor

If a probe is not public then certain details, including exact IP addresses, are not returned.

When the probe connected for the last time (UTC Time and date in ISO-8601/ECMA 262 format)

Format"date-time"

The IPv4 prefix if any

The IPv6 prefix if any

object
Required

An object describing the probe status.

Status ID.

  • 0 - Never Connected
  • 1 - Connected
  • 2 - Disconnected
  • 3 - Abandoned
  • 4 - Written Off
Valid values01234

Human-readable status name.

  • Never Connected - 0
  • Connected - 1
  • Disconnected - 2
  • Abandoned - 3
  • Written Off - 4
Valid values"Never Connected""Connected""Disconnected""Abandoned""Written Off"

Time the status last changed.

Format"date-time"

Time the status last changed.

Format"date-time"
object[]
Required

Human-readable tag name.

Lower-case, hyphenated tag slug.

Accumulated uptime for this probe in seconds

The type of the object

Samples